This course focuses on a range of pathological conditions and the principles of pharmacology in their management. An understanding of disease processes is fundamental to the development of a knowledge base required to practise as a competent registered nurse. Knowledge of pharmacology is required to guide safe practice in the administration of therapeutic substances. The course explores the mechanisms involved in the breakdown of homeostasis along with interventions designed to achieve a return to homeostasis and includes a broad range of pathophysiological conditions throughout the body systems.
